Ontario's premier urging young people to stop going to parties after a recent increase in COVID-19 cases.
"Hold off on these parties. I don't know why everyone wants to party so badly, but enough," Premier Doug Ford said yesterday after Ontario Health officials reported 203 new cases. "We have to keep this in control."
The latest stats show 116 of the new cases can be attributed to people 39 years of age or younger.
Canada's Deputy Chief of Public Health Dr. Howard Njoo believes an 'invincibility factor' may be at play among young people.
